Painting Description
"Anioł z Banderolą" (Angel with a Banner) is a notable work by Stanisław Wyspiański, a multifaceted Polish artist, playwright, poet, and painter, who played a significant role in the Polish Modernist movement at the turn of the 20th century. This piece, like many of Wyspiański's works, showcases his exceptional talent in blending national themes with innovative artistic expressions. "Anioł z Banderolą" is particularly significant for its symbolic representation and its place within the broader context of Wyspiański's artistic and literary oeuvre, which often explored themes of national identity, freedom, and the spiritual and cultural heritage of Poland.
Stanisław Wyspiański (1869–1907) was deeply involved in the intellectual and artistic life of Kraków, a city that was a cradle of Polish culture and national consciousness during the partitions of Poland. His works are characterized by their deep symbolism, intricate detail, and the fusion of various art forms. Wyspiański's mastery in different mediums – from pastel to stained glass, from drama to poetry – allowed him to create a unique and cohesive artistic vision that was both deeply personal and universally resonant with the Polish struggle for independence and cultural survival.
"Anioł z Banderolą" reflects Wyspiański's profound engagement with Polish history and mythology, embedding symbolic meanings that transcend its immediate visual appeal. The work is emblematic of Wyspiański's ability to convey complex national and existential themes through a highly individual style, combining elements of Art Nouveau with a distinct Polish sensibility. The angel in the artwork, often interpreted as a messenger bearing news of liberation or awakening, can be seen as a metaphor for the artist's hope for Poland's resurgence and the revival of its cultural and political sovereignty.
As with many of Wyspiański's creations, "Anioł z Banderolą" is not just a piece of art but a statement embedded within the broader narrative of Polish art and nationalism at the end of the 19th and the beginning of the 20th century. It stands as a testament to Wyspiański's genius and his enduring legacy in Polish culture and the wider art world. Through works like "Anioł z Banderolą," Wyspiański continues to inspire discussions on the role of art in national identity and the power of cultural expression as a form of resistance and renewal.
